Released June 12th, 2009, 'Street Dreams' stars Paul Rodriguez, Ryan Dunn, Rob Dyrdek, Terry Kennedy The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 28 min, and received a user score of 62 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 6 respected users.
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Derrick Cabrera, like all skateboarders, dreams of being sponsored one day. He has all the talent in the world to make it happen but some major roadblocks to overcome before he can make the dream a reality."
